From Hardware to Software: What's Really Changing?



The term "software-defined car" might seem futuristic, yet possibilities are you've already seen one in action. These cars rely greatly on integrated software systems to manage everything from home entertainment to steering. As opposed to separated digital control devices managing tasks separately, software-defined automobiles make use of streamlined computing to manage the automobile holistically. That shift brings huge ease, however likewise brand-new obligations for proprietors and professionals.



Unlike conventional lorries, where wear and tear is very easy to spot and diagnose, software-defined cars and trucks usually store efficiency information, mistake codes, and system health reports deep within interior digital systems. This means diagnostics currently call for specific tools and software program proficiency. A mechanic can not rely exclusively on noise, smell, or resonance-- they additionally require to read the information.

Updates Over the Air-- and Under the Radar



Among one of the most revolutionary changes brought by software-defined automobiles is the concept of over-the-air updates. These updates can fine-tune engine efficiency, add safety features, or take care of bugs, just like a mobile phone. What when needed a trip to a store now happens quietly while your auto beings in the driveway.



Yet this benefit has trade-offs. Owners need to stay sharp to update notices, just as they would for a phone or computer. Ignoring them can cause concerns later on, especially when efficiency, safety and security, or connection is at risk.



Still, this kind of positive upkeep represents an exciting progression. Envision improvements that roll out instantly, keeping your vehicle safer and smarter without a wrench ever being lifted.
